**Job Description**:
Reporting to the Centre Manager you will get involved in the coordination of all aspects of administration, account management and extensive client/tenant liaison. This is a fantastic opportunity to utilise your customer service and administration skills in this varied and valued role.
Some of your key responsibilities will include:
- Account management including rental collection, arrears reconciliations and accounts payable
- Preparation of monthly reports
- Maintenance of tenant/contractor records and files, including public liability details, tenant files, lease and licence agreements, bank guarantees, contracts and correspondence
- Updating and maintaining all lease admin data including interpreting leases, incentive deeds and various commercial documents.
- Review with Property Managers/Finance any account reconciliations in line with lease terms and other agreements
- Telephone enquiries from customer, tenants & contractors
- Assisting Centre Manager with the creation of budgets and reconciliations
- Processing invoices and work orders
